What is avocado oil: Basics and production
Definition and sources
I open a bottle and check the label to confirm it is avocado oil, not a seed oil. Avocado oil is pressed from the ripe fruit flesh, or pulp, not from the seed. This distinction matters for flavor, composition, and stability. The primary sources come from established avocado-growing regions; environmental conditions, cultivar choice, and post-harvest handling shape the final product. The oil’s identity is tied to its source and its extraction pathway, which then guides formulation decisions and regulatory labeling.
Extraction methods and processing
The production path can be straightforward or complex, depending on the grade sought. Virgin and extra-virgin grades are typically produced by mechanical pressing, often at lower heat. Refined or neutral oils use solvent-assisted or high-heat processing to achieve a milder flavor and higher heat tolerance. Each step—mechanical extraction, filtration, optional refining—affects aroma, color, stability, and shelf life. When you decide on a grade, you define the use context: dressings and cold applications favor virgin oils for flavor; high-heat cooking relies on refined oils with better smoke points. Quality grades and labeling
Clear labeling matters for consumer trust and regulatory compliance. Virgin/extra-virgin oils offer unrefined flavor profiles, while refined oils provide neutral flavors and greater heat stability. Each grade suits a different use case, and labeling should reflect processing method, purity, and claimed attributes (for example, organic or non-GMO). Transparency about composition—such as oleic acid content, tocopherols, and carotenoids—supports differentiation and consumer understanding. Storage recommendations, if included, reinforce brand credibility and product stewardship.
Composition and stability
Avocado oil typically features a fatty-acid profile rich in monounsaturated fats, especially oleic acid, with smaller amounts of polyunsaturated and saturated fats. Bioactive constituents, including vitamin E (tocopherols) and carotenoids, contribute antioxidant properties and color. Stability hinges on exposure to light, heat, and air. Packaging choices—dark bottles, inert caps, and tight seals—extend shelf life and preserve quality. In practice, this means a supply-chain design that prioritizes consistent shipping conditions, proper storage guidance, and robust QA testing to minimize batch-to-batch variability.

Avocado Oil Health Benefits: Evidence, mechanisms, and practical relevance
Cardiovascular and metabolic health
Early signals suggest that avocado oil’s monounsaturated fat profile, particularly oleic acid, may be associated with favorable lipid patterns and anti-inflammatory potential in some studies. Observational and limited interventional data point to potential improvements in lipid markers and inflammatory status, though robust human trials are still needed to draw definitive conclusions for disease prevention claims. In business terms, the context matters: dietary intake and topical use produce different risk/benefit profiles, which should be reflected in claims and product positioning.

Skin, hair, and topical applications
The cosmetic relevance of avocado oil rests on emollient and barrier-supporting properties. In products designed for skin or hair, formulation choices—like viscosity, absorption rate, and fragrance—substantially influence user experience and efficacy. Vitamin E and carotenoids contribute antioxidant benefits, supporting narratives around aging and photoprotection, but claims must be supported by credible, product-relevant data. When testing topicals, you should record sensory outcomes, such as skin feel and residue, as well as any empirical measures like moisture retention in controlled tests.
Antioxidant and anti-inflammatory mechanisms
Tocopherols and carotenoids act as lipid-soluble antioxidants, potentially reducing oxidative stress in product matrices. Monounsaturated fats may modulate certain inflammatory pathways, though translating mechanisms to clinical outcomes is not straightforward. Safety, risks, and quality assurance
Thermal properties and culinary use
Avocado oil’s thermal behavior varies by grade. Refined oils generally tolerate higher cooking temperatures, enabling broad high-heat culinary use; virgin oils offer flavor advantages but lower heat tolerance. For menu design and product development, this means matching grade to application and controlling for potential oxidation over time. In practice, monitor smoke points and signs of degradation during storage and cooking trials. Guidance to consumers should emphasize choosing the right grade for the intended use and storing oil away from direct light or heat.
Allergen considerations (latex-fruit syndrome)
Allergen considerations matter for risk assessment and consumer communications. Some individuals with latex-fruit syndrome may experience cross-reactivity with avocado; disclose potential allergen information as required by local regulations and company policy. Practically, this means ingredient labeling and customer-facing safety statements should reflect jurisdictional requirements and ensure clarity without overstating risk.
Oxidation, storage, shelf life
Exposure to light, heat, and air accelerates oxidation, so packaging that minimizes light exposure and air ingress is critical. Real-time and accelerated stability testing support shelf-life determinations and use-by date labeling. Provide consumer guidance on storage—cool, dark places—and define post-open timelines that balance safety with practical use.
Contaminants, adulteration, and quality control
Robust supplier qualification, COA verification, and third-party analysis reduce risks of solvent residues or adulteration. Routine testing of fatty-acid profiles, tocopherol content, and sensory quality supports consistency and brand integrity. Implement GMP and traceability programs to mitigate recalls and regulatory exposure. For leadership teams, these controls translate into a valuation of supplier reliability and brand risk management.
Regulatory landscape, claims, and compliance
US FDA labeling and health claims
In the United States, avoid disease treatment or cure claims. Use permitted nutrient-content or structure/function claims with substantiation, and ensure labeling complies with FDA requirements for ingredient lists, nutrition facts, and truthful advertising. Maintain robust records and consider third-party verification to enhance credibility. This is not merely legal housekeeping; it directly affects marketing strategy, channel eligibility, and potential premium positioning.
